Steel Frame: Synonymous with Elegance and Functionality
Steel frame construction is not only renowned for its strength and efficiency, but also for its ability to create open, flexible, and bright spaces.
This technique allows great design freedom, removing the limitations of traditional construction methods. The result is a home free from unnecessary elements—one that embraces elegant simplicity and functional order.
Minimalism in steel frame construction also translates into energy efficiency. These homes are easier to insulate and maintain at a consistent temperature, reducing the need for excessive heating or cooling systems. Less expense, less environmental impact, and more time to enjoy what truly matters.
Moreover, steel frame buildings are more durable and resistant, minimizing the need for frequent repairs and maintenance. This makes them especially appealing to those who want a home that is not only aesthetically pleasing, but also practical and easy to live in.
